About Breakthrough Cincinnati

Breakthrough Cincinnati (BTC) is a tuition-free academic enrichment program for middle school students, where undergraduate college students are given the opportunity to be trained as a teacher and lead their own classroom.

The Breakthrough Collaborative teaching residency is designed for undergraduates of all majors. Ideal candidates have a deep commitment to social justice and passion for working with middle-school students. Our teaching fellows are committed to personal growth and are comfortable working in a fast-paced environment. Though a demanding job, the rewards—teaching motivated and hard-working students who dream of college, working alongside the most committed and passionate college students from across the country, and receiving guidance and support from instructional coaches—are unparalleled.
